本文目录导读:
关系数据模型作为数据库设计的基础理论,自20世纪70年代以来,一直是数据库领域的核心,关系数据模型以其简洁、直观、易于理解等优点,在各个领域得到了广泛应用,本文将深入剖析关系数据模型的组成,探讨其在数据库中的应用。
图片来源于网络,如有侵权联系删除
关系数据模型的组成
1、数据结构
关系数据模型采用二维表格结构,由行和列组成,每一行代表一个实体,称为元组;每一列代表实体的一个属性,称为属性,关系中的元组具有唯一性,即没有两个元组完全相同。
2、数据操作
关系数据模型提供了四种基本的数据操作,即插入、删除、修改和查询。
(1)插入:向关系中添加新的元组。
(2)删除:从关系中删除特定的元组。
(3)修改:修改关系中特定元组的属性值。
(4)查询:从关系中检索满足特定条件的元组。
3、数据约束
关系数据模型提供了三种数据约束,即实体完整性约束、参照完整性约束和用户定义的完整性约束。
图片来源于网络,如有侵权联系删除
(1)实体完整性约束:保证每个元组在关系中具有唯一标识。
(2)参照完整性约束:保证关系中引用的外键与被引用的主键相对应。
(3)用户定义的完整性约束:根据应用需求,对数据进行特定的约束。
4、关系模式
关系模式是关系的框架,由属性名、属性类型和属性约束组成,关系模式定义了关系的结构,是数据库设计的核心。
5、关系实例
关系实例是关系模式的具体实现,由一系列满足关系模式约束的元组组成,关系实例随着数据的变化而变化。
关系数据模型在数据库中的应用
1、数据库设计
关系数据模型为数据库设计提供了理论基础,通过分析实体和实体之间的关系,设计出符合实际应用需求的关系模式。
2、数据库查询
图片来源于网络,如有侵权联系删除
关系数据模型提供了丰富的查询语言,如SQL,方便用户从数据库中检索所需数据。
3、数据库维护
关系数据模型支持数据的插入、删除、修改和查询操作,便于数据库的维护和管理。
4、数据库安全性
关系数据模型提供了数据约束,如实体完整性约束和参照完整性约束,确保数据库中的数据符合实际需求,提高数据的安全性。
5、数据库标准化
关系数据模型支持数据库的规范化,通过分解关系模式,消除数据冗余,提高数据库的效率。
关系数据模型作为一种成熟的数据库设计理论,在数据库领域具有广泛的应用,本文深入剖析了关系数据模型的组成,探讨了其在数据库设计、查询、维护、安全性和标准化等方面的应用,随着数据库技术的发展,关系数据模型将继续在数据库领域发挥重要作用。
标签: #关系数据模型的组成
评论列表